Abstract
PURPOSE: To attain smooth drawing out of a core wire without a break or the like of the core wire on a device for drawing out a core wire from a carrier to a subsequent next process by designing a rotating mechanism for a rotary member at the top of the carrier which is driven through a guide pulley to have a structure which meets a specific equation.
CONSTITUTION: A core wire being drawn out passes around a guide pulley 13 secured to a rotary member 1 at the top of a frame of a carrier 3 and is accepted for a subsequent next process. The thus moving core wire rotates the pulley 13 to thus rotate the rotary member 1 through a driving pulley 14, a tapered pulley 7, a pinion 8 having the number NA of teeth, an idle gear 9 and an internal gear 5 having the number NB of teeth. This gear train is designed to have a structure which meets an equation NB/NA=D/d-1, where D is an average diameter of wound turns of the core wire, and (d) is an effective diameter of the guide pulley 13. By this structure, since the rotary member 1 makes one complete rotation for drawing out of the core wire for one complete turn, the core wire is not waved about nor squeezed and hence it is never broken on this device.
